**Job Title: DIE Maintenance Technician** If interested contact Austin @ (517) 455-4718 *** **Objectives** **:** + Ensuring timely and proper repair of damaged dies, minimizing production delays. **Main Responsibilities** **:** 1. **Repairing and maintaining Progressive and Transfer dies** : Core to the role, ensuring the dies are functional and efficient. 2. **Performing preventative maintenance** : Preventing potential die problems by conducting regular checks and maintenance. 3. **Diagnosing and repairing die issues during production** : Troubleshooting and addressing issues as they arise to keep production running smoothly. 4. **Conducting test runs post-repair** : Ensuring repaired parts meet required specifications. 5. **Using forklifts and power jacks** : Transporting dies to and from the tool room as needed. 6. **Operating an overhead crane** : A regular part of the role for moving heavy dies or equipment. 7. **Maintaining a clean and safe work area** : Ensuring the workspace is orderly to promote safety. 8. **Supporting other tool room duties** : Flexibility to assist in other tasks as required. **Experience, Education, and Skill Requirements** **:** + **Education** : High school diploma or GED is required. + **Experience** : At least five years of tool-making or die repair/maintenance experience, particularly with Progressive and Transfer dies. + **Skills** : + Proficient in using tool room equipment (mills, lathes, grinders). + Ability to TIG weld and use grinders/polishers for handwork. + Familiarity with reading blueprints and using the metric system. **Physical Requirements** **:** + Ability to lift up to 75 lbs. + Must be comfortable with repetitive motions and standing for extended periods (8-12 hours). + Frequent bending, twisting, stooping, and kneeling is required. **Summary:** **This role requires a combination of technical skills, including die repair, equipment operation, and a strong physical capacity for handling heavy machinery and performing detailed work.
